Elena Rybakina escaped the trap set by Dayana Yastremska this Saturday in Montreal. The Kazakh player advanced to the quarterfinals after a tight match, winning 5-7, 6-2, 7-5.
In the press conference, she spoke about her victory after a 2-hour and 33-minute battle: "I'm a bit tired with these long matches, but I'm managing.
Overall, I'm happy to be ready to play these long matches. I think, in the end, it's good preparation for the US Open.
Against Marta Kostyuk, I’ll try to focus on myself. I know she’s a fighter and a tough opponent physically.
